The impact of AI and ML in healthcare is profound. Integrated Electronic Health Records (EHRs) now enable healthcare professionals to access patient information in real time, minimizing medication errors and reducing communication gaps among specialists. AI-driven diagnostics further enhance this process, allowing physicians to detect conditions with greater accuracy and speed. Telemedicine, accelerated by these advancements, has also removed geographical barriers, enabling patients to consult with specialists from the comfort of their homes.

In the insurance sector, similar transformations are taking place. Traditional pain points such as fraudulent claims, sluggish approvals, and imprecise risk assessments are being addressed with intelligent systems. Digital claims platforms supported by ML allow users to file and track claims online, significantly reducing paperwork and processing time. Meanwhile, algorithms evaluate a wider range of real-time data to deliver more accurate and customized premium calculations.

AI operates like a precision tool in modern healthcare—analyzing medical imagery, monitoring health metrics in real time, and supporting clinical decisions. ML, by contrast, continuously learns from vast datasets to uncover patterns and generate predictive insights. For instance, DeepMind’s collaboration with Moorfields Eye Hospital and University College London produced an AI that could diagnose over 50 eye conditions with 94% accuracy by analyzing 3D retinal scans. Though not yet widely deployed in clinics, such technology showcases the potential for AI to enhance diagnostic capacity at scale.

In insurance, innovations are also gaining momentum. AI tools are redefining fraud detection and claims assessment. One standout example is Swiss Re’s Life Guide Scout, an AI-powered platform developed in partnership with Microsoft Azure. Using generative AI, this solution is poised to revolutionize the underwriting process by delivering faster, data-driven assessments. Although currently in testing, it is projected to become a game-changer by the end of 2024.

These advancements, however, do not come without challenges. Data privacy remains a top concern. As sensitive health and insurance information is digitized, robust cybersecurity frameworks must be in place to protect users from breaches and misuse. Moreover, integrating new technologies with existing legacy systems poses significant technical hurdles for both healthcare providers and insurers.

Ethical concerns also demand attention. Since AI systems are driven by data, the risk of biased decision-making persists. Transparency in algorithmic processes and continuous monitoring are crucial to building trust and ensuring fairness in automated decisions.

Looking ahead, emerging technologies like blockchain and Natural Language Processing (NLP) are expected to take this digital transformation further. Blockchain can simplify data management by making medical records easily portable and secure. In insurance, it promises to streamline claims processing and prevent fraud. Meanwhile, NLP enables more intuitive interactions, allowing patients to receive healthcare advice or manage insurance policies using voice commands.

Predictive analytics also signals a shift from reactive to proactive care. Wearable devices can alert users to early health risks, prompting preventive interventions. In insurance, real-time data from smart homes or connected vehicles can adjust coverage and premiums dynamically based on actual behavior, offering tailored protection.
